Growing Roots On St. Simons is the seventh episode of the seventeenth season of Island Life. It follows the journey of a couple, Lisa and Craig, as they search for their dream home on St. Simons Island, Georgia. As Bay Area natives, Lisa and Craig are excited to relocate to a quieter, more laid-back lifestyle on the East Coast.
The episode begins with Lisa and Craig meeting their real estate agent, Milly, who shows them three potential properties on the island. The first property is an old beach cottage that has been renovated with a modern twist. Although Lisa loves the charm of the cottage, Craig is hesitant about the small living space.
The second property is a spacious ranch-style home with a large backyard and pool area. The couple is impressed with the size of the property, but Lisa doesn't feel like it's close enough to the beach. Craig, on the other hand, loves the privacy and quietness of the neighborhood.
The final property is a newer construction with a beachy vibe. The couple is immediately drawn to the bright and airy feel of the home, but the price is over their budget. Milly suggests making an offer that's lower than the asking price, which Lisa and Craig decide to do.
After some negotiation, Lisa and Craig's offer is accepted and they move forward with the purchase of the third property. The couple reflects on their decision to move to St. Simons Island and the lifestyle they're looking forward to. They're excited about the prospect of growing roots in their new home and making memories for years to come.
